Ohio man gets 40 years in prison; dumped body on I-90 near Cleveland
CLEVELAND (AP) — An Ohio man has been sentenced to 40 years to life in prison for strangling a woman whose body was dumped along Interstate 90 and later mistaken by Cleveland police for a deer carcass.
Judge Joseph Russo of Cuyahoga County Common Pleas Court today sentenced 31-year-old Stephon Davis of Cleveland.
He pleaded guilty Wednesday to aggravated murder and aggravated robbery in the 2010 death of 26-year-old Angel Bradley-Crockett of Cleveland.
Prosecutors think she was killed after an argument over a minor traffic accident and may have left with Davis to handle the matter.
The victim was beaten, strangled and robbed, and her naked body was dumped along Interstate 90. A two-man patrol car dispatched to the scene drove by and called a highway crew about a deer carcass on the road.
